Job Overview:

The Corporate Development Senior Analyst will play a support role in assisting the Corporate Development team with strategic transactions and acquisitions for our organization. This position will focus on providing analytical and operational support throughout the deal lifecycle, from initial evaluation to post-acquisition analysis, under the guidance of more senior team members. By collaborating with internal stakeholders and external advisors, you will contribute to the overall success and growth of our organization.

This is a hybrid role that requires 3 days per week in the office. There is no option to be fully remote.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Transaction Support:Assist in various stages of transactions and acquisitions, including initial evaluations, financial modeling, due diligence, and post-acquisition analysis. Support the team in preparing necessary documentation and presentations for key stakeholders.

  • Financial Analysis:Contribute to the development of financial projections and perform detailed financial analysis. Assist in creating pro forma financial models, conducting valuation analysis, and developing synergy models to support decision-making on potential transactions.

  • Strategic Assessment:Collaborate with business leaders to understand strategic priorities and assist in identifying suitable M&A targets that align with the organization’s goals.

  • Pipeline Management:Maintain a comprehensive and organized view of the target pipeline. Assist in compiling relevant documentation and managing the flow of information to support strategic decision-making.

  • Collaborative Deal Execution:Work alongside internal functional teams (e.g., legal, finance) and external advisors to contribute to a smooth deal execution, ensuring all necessary approval and process steps are followed.

  • Process Support:Support the optimization of corporate development processes to enhance efficiency and effectiveness. Assist in the development of playbooks and best practices.

  • Post-Acquisition Integration Support:Provide assistance in post-acquisition integration efforts, helping to ensure that cross-functional teams effectively execute their M&A integration plans.

  • Presentation Development:Aid in the creation of high-quality presentation materials and reports for practice leaders and senior management, ensuring clarity and professionalism.

  • Ad-Hoc Projects:Participate in various ad-hoc projects and activities as required, providing analytical support and insights to the Corporate Development team.
